Online. Better selections than yarn stores.
Yarns ..... I order online from Herrschners, Premier Yarns, Little Knits, Knit Picks, Lion Brand, and Webs (yarn.com). Get on their email lists for specials / sales.
Herrschners' house brand yarns are excellent. They carry a wide variety of brands.
Patterns - Both patterns and "do it myself." Or - combinations. I alter patterns frequently. (I just agonized over a mohair sweater ... but it turned out OK. Not great - but OK. )
Download free from Berroco, Lion Brand, Garn Studio, Premier.
Garn Studio has the best selection of patterns, but the instructions are advanced.
Premier and Lion Brand have "current" styles.
I get Vogue Knitting and Interweave Knitting monthly mags w/patterns. Vogue Knitting website has some free patterns.
I buy technique knitting and crochet books and pattern books from Amazon.
I particularly like NORO yarns and frequently buy their books and magazines. If you aren't familiar with NORO - check them out at Little Knits website. Expensive - but fantastic. They are a Japanese company.
There are some European magazines that print English editions - usually find them at the magazine stand in Barnes & Noble. The German knitting mags are the best.
